NettetLeft singular vectors, returned as the columns of a matrix. If A is an m-by-n matrix and you request k singular values, then U is an m-by-k matrix with orthonormal columns.. Different machines, releases of MATLAB ®, or parameters (such as the starting vector and subspace dimension) can produce different singular vectors that are still … NettetShort-term electricity load forecasting is key to the safe, reliable, and economical operation of power systems. However, we can also reconstruct the image using a small number of singular values and vectors: A = Ak = σ1u1vT 1 + σ2u2vT 2 + … + σkukvT k. grandmother cartoon pngNettet18. okt. 2024 · The diagonal values in the Sigma matrix are known as the singular values of the original matrix A. The columns of the U matrix are called the left-singular vectors of A, and the columns of V are called the right-singular vectors of A. The SVD is calculated via iterative numerical methods.
